I'm always on the lookout for great sites to read fantasy novels online, and one of my top picks is Project Gutenberg. It's a treasure trove for classic fantasy works that are in the public domain. You can download or read online titles like 'The Hobbit' or 'A Princess of Mars' without any hassle. The site is straightforward, no flashy ads, just pure reading pleasure. Another solid option is ManyBooks, which offers a wide range of fantasy novels in PDF format, from indie authors to big names. The user interface is clean, making it easy to find your next read. For those who enjoy a mix of old and new, Open Library is fantastic because it lets you borrow digital copies of fantasy novels, including some hard-to-find gems. These sites are my go-to because they are reliable, easy to use, and packed with content that any fantasy lover would appreciate.

Finding the perfect spot to dive into fantasy novels online can feel like discovering a hidden magical realm. My absolute favorite is Archive.org, a digital library that not only hosts a vast collection of fantasy PDFs but also offers a unique 'borrow' feature for copyrighted books. I've spent countless hours there exploring everything from 'The Lord of the Rings' to obscure fantasy series.

Another gem is Scribd, which feels like a Netflix for books. It has an extensive selection of fantasy novels, and while it requires a subscription, the sheer volume of content makes it worth it. I often stumble upon new authors and series I wouldn't have found otherwise.

For those who prefer a more community-driven experience, Wattpad is a fun alternative. While it's known for user-generated content, there are some hidden fantasy gems if you dig deep. The interactive comments and engagement with authors add a social layer to reading.

Lastly, Google Books is surprisingly useful for free previews and full PDFs of older fantasy works. It's not as curated as other sites, but it's a great supplement when you're hunting for something specific.

When I need to read fantasy novels online, I prioritize sites that offer both variety and convenience. One standout is LibriVox, which is perfect for audiobook lovers but also provides PDF versions of many fantasy classics. The volunteer-read audiobooks add a personal touch, and the accompanying texts are great for following along.

Another reliable choice is Feedbooks, which has a dedicated section for fantasy. The site is sleek, and the books are well-organized, making it easy to find exactly what you're in the mood for. I often recommend it to friends who are new to digital reading.

For a more niche experience, Baen Books' Free Library is a must-visit. It specializes in sci-fi and fantasy, offering free samples and full novels from their authors. It's a great way to discover new series without committing upfront.

These sites cater to different reading preferences, whether you're after classics, indie finds, or publisher-backed content. Each offers a unique way to enjoy fantasy novels online, ensuring there's something for every type of reader.

How To Convert Novels To Reading Pdf Online Format?

3 Answers2025-07-19 08:40:39
I've been converting my favorite novels to PDF for years, and it's easier than you think. The simplest method is using free online tools like Calibre or online-convert. Just upload your novel file, select PDF as the output format, and download the converted file. For text-based novels, I sometimes copy the content into a word processor like Google Docs, format it nicely, and then export as PDF. Another trick is using print-to-PDF features on browsers or devices. If the novel is from a website, right-click and select 'Print,' then choose 'Save as PDF.' This works great for preserving the original formatting without any fancy software.

Can I Convert Pdf To Epub Online For Kindle Reading?

4 Answers2025-07-05 17:07:25
As someone who reads extensively on my Kindle, I've experimented with various ways to convert PDFs to EPUB for a smoother reading experience. While PDFs are great for preserving layout, they don't reflow text well on e-readers. Online converters like Zamzar, Online-Convert, and CloudConvert are lifesavers—just upload your PDF, select EPUB as the output, and download. Some even let you tweak settings like margins or font size. However, not all conversions are perfect. Scanned PDFs or complex layouts might turn into a mess. For those, tools like Calibre (though not online) offer more control. Amazon’s Send to Kindle service also accepts PDFs, but EPUB is now natively supported, making conversions less urgent. Always check the output file before sideloading to your Kindle to avoid formatting disasters.
